Understanding Internet Infrastructure Providers (IIP)
First off, let’s talk about Internet Infrastructure Providers (IIP). These are the backbone of the internet, the unsung heroes making sure all your cat videos and late-night gaming sessions run smoothly. An IIP provides the physical and virtual infrastructure necessary for websites and online services to operate. This includes data centers, servers, network equipment, and the fiber optic cables that crisscross the globe. Without a robust IIP, the internet as we know it would simply grind to a halt.
From an SEO perspective, the choice of an IIP can significantly impact website performance. A reliable IIP ensures minimal downtime, fast loading speeds, and robust security. These factors are crucial for ranking well in search engine results. Google and other search engines prioritize websites that offer a seamless user experience. If your site is constantly crashing or loading slowly, you can bet your rankings will suffer.
Moreover, a good IIP will offer scalable solutions, allowing your website to handle increased traffic without performance degradation. This scalability is vital for businesses experiencing growth or seasonal traffic spikes. Investing in a quality IIP is an investment in your website's long-term success and visibility.

The Role of SEO in the Digital Ecosystem
Now, let's talk about SEO (Search Engine Optimization). In simple terms, SEO is the art and science of making your website more visible to search engines like Google. The higher your website ranks in search results, the more organic (non-paid) traffic you'll receive. And let's be honest, who doesn't want free traffic?
SEO involves a wide range of techniques, including keyword research, on-page optimization, link building, and technical SEO. Keyword research helps you identify the terms and phrases that your target audience is searching for. On-page optimization involves tweaking your website's content and HTML code to make it more search engine friendly. Link building is the process of acquiring backlinks from other reputable websites, which signals to search engines that your site is trustworthy and authoritative. Technical SEO focuses on improving your website's infrastructure, such as site speed, mobile-friendliness, and crawlability.
Effective SEO is crucial for any online business or organization. It's not enough to have a great website; you need to make sure people can find it. By optimizing your site for search engines, you can attract qualified leads, increase brand awareness, and ultimately drive more revenue.
SEO is not a one-time effort; it's an ongoing process that requires constant monitoring and adaptation. Search engine algorithms are constantly evolving, so you need to stay up-to-date with the latest best practices. But trust me, the effort is well worth it. A well-executed SEO strategy can deliver significant returns in the form of increased traffic, higher rankings, and more customers.
Security Content Automation Protocol (SCAP)
Okay, let's switch gears and talk about SCAP (Security Content Automation Protocol). This might sound like something out of a sci-fi movie, but it's actually a set of standards that help organizations automate the process of assessing and managing security vulnerabilities. SCAP provides a standardized way to identify software flaws, configuration issues, and other security weaknesses.
From an IIP perspective, SCAP is essential for maintaining a secure infrastructure. IIPs are responsible for protecting vast amounts of data and ensuring the availability of online services. By using SCAP, IIPs can proactively identify and address security vulnerabilities before they can be exploited by hackers.
SCAP compliance also helps IIPs meet regulatory requirements. Many industries and governments have strict security standards that require organizations to regularly assess and remediate vulnerabilities. SCAP provides a standardized framework for meeting these requirements.
In the context of SEO, security is paramount. A hacked website can suffer significant damage to its reputation and search engine rankings. Google and other search engines penalize websites that are known to be insecure. By implementing SCAP and maintaining a strong security posture, you can protect your website from cyberattacks and maintain your SEO rankings.
User Experience Testing (UEST)
Next up, we have UEST (User Experience Testing). This involves evaluating how users interact with your website or application to identify areas for improvement. UEST can take many forms, including usability testing, A/B testing, and surveys.
The goal of UEST is to create a website or application that is easy to use, enjoyable, and effective. A positive user experience can lead to increased engagement, higher conversion rates, and greater customer satisfaction.
In the world of SEO, user experience is a critical ranking factor. Google and other search engines prioritize websites that offer a seamless and enjoyable user experience. Factors such as site speed, mobile-friendliness, and ease of navigation all contribute to user experience.
By conducting regular UEST, you can identify and address usability issues that may be hurting your SEO rankings. For example, if users are struggling to find information on your website, you can improve the navigation or content organization to make it easier for them to find what they're looking for. Similarly, if your website is slow to load, you can optimize images or implement caching to improve site speed.
Automated Security Scanning (ASS)
Let's move on to ASS (Automated Security Scanning). No, we're not being cheeky here! This refers to the process of using automated tools to identify security vulnerabilities in your website or application. These tools can scan for common security flaws, such as SQL injection, cross-site scripting (XSS), and other types of vulnerabilities.
Automated security scanning is an essential part of a comprehensive security strategy. It allows you to quickly and efficiently identify potential security weaknesses before they can be exploited by attackers. By regularly scanning your website or application, you can proactively address vulnerabilities and reduce your risk of a security breach.
From an SEO perspective, automated security scanning is crucial for protecting your website's reputation and search engine rankings. As mentioned earlier, Google penalizes websites that are known to be insecure. By implementing automated security scanning, you can demonstrate to Google that you take security seriously and are proactive about protecting your website and users.
